POSITION SUMMARY
The CMA/MA/LPN, under the direction of the physician or other designated licensed staff, provides routine patient care in an ambulatory setting.  The CMA/MA/LPN is able to work as part of a team and perform both clinical and administrative duties.  Clinical duties may include taking and recording vital signs and medical histories, preparing patients for examination/procedure, sterilization of medical instruments and administering medications as directed by provider or designee.  Administrative duties may include scheduling appointments, maintaining medical records and filling out insurance forms/paperwork.
 
POSITION TECHNICAL R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Manages patient flow and performs patient rooming workflows.
  • Demonstrates and understands infection control, sterile and aseptic techniques.  Uses appropriate techniques in setting up or assisting with procedure.
  • Enters and processes all orders (e.g. diagnostic, office procedures) and assists in the scheduling of procedures.
  • Assists medical provider with processing of diagnostic results.
  • Administers medications by all routes excluding intravenous infusion.  Demonstrates and understands administration techniques, recognizes and reports effects and side effects of medication, and instructs patient appropriately.
  • Collects and records accurate telephone information and relays it to medical provider or nurse in a timely manner.
  • Cleans, prepares, and autoclaves equipment and instruments in preparation for sterilizations per infection control policies and procedures.
  • Check inventory and order supplies as needed. 
  • Provides patient education only under the direction of medical provider or nurse.
  • Performs delegated MD/Nursing acts commensurate with education, training, competency and experience.
  • Schedule referrals/outpatient diagnostic procedures including patient prep information and coordinate prior authorizations
  • Collect laboratory samples.
  • Depending upon location and/or department may be responsible for basic computer scheduling, rescheduling, canceling and coordination of appointments.
  • Assists in emergency situations.  Cross train and staff other clinics as needed.
  • Participates in site process improvement teams
  • Performs other duties as required.
